Major Duties:

  • You will do daily inspections and operational tests of all emergency arresting gear and Optical. Visual Landing Systems in accordance with directives and maintenance requirements.
  • You will clean all equipment assigned, such as slots in deck covers plates, checking for foreign matter, and other inspections.
  • You will read mechanical blueprints and wiring diagrams.
  • You will maintain files, reports, logs and prepare proper correspondence in a timely manner in accordance with directives.

Qualifications: Your resume must also dem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the WG-10 grade level or p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ate the following: ) Assisting in the daily inspection, operational tests, and repairs to arresting gear, cables, and optical landing systems; 2) Compiling a list of required parts, supplies, and components to submit for approval; 3) Identifying repair needs for emergency arresting gear and optical landing systems; and 4) Submitting aircraft launching and arrestment device-related files, reports, and logs to supervisor for inspection and approval.
